Output d31af76f0760dbc208743c2f87990c10ea5d82791e04252929c4dc8f3b454d2a:0

value
16682
script pubkey
OP_0 OP_PUSHBYTES_20 5295572c71e9b256e2fe8f7ddabb6a0e9f587767
address
bc1q2224wtr3axe9dch73a7a4wm2p604sam8x3yvfe
transaction
d31af76f0760dbc208743c2f87990c10ea5d82791e04252929c4dc8f3b454d2a
spent
true